From f575d9973a04c1bce964e2fdcb3196ebc5ca6d29 Mon Sep 17 00:00:00 2001 From: frakarr Date: Sun, 7 Dec 2025 00:30:14 +0100 Subject: [PATCH] Update Dockerfile --- server/Dockerfile |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) diff --git a/server/Dockerfile b/server/Dockerfile index e69de29..736a6b8 100644 --- a/server/Dockerfile +++ b/server/Dockerfile @@ -0,0 +1,18 @@ +FROM node:18-alpine + +WORKDIR /app + +# Copia package.json e package-lock.json (se esiste) +COPY package*.json ./ + +# Installa solo le dipendenze di produzione +RUN npm install --production + +# Copia il codice sorgente del server +COPY . . + +# Espone la porta definita nel server.js (default 3001) +EXPOSE 3001 + +# Avvia il server +CMD ["npm", "start"]